Ahead of the Game - Data Privacy in an AI Landscape
play

01/05/24 • 54 min

How do you care for the data you collect from leads and customers? Can you be sure it's secure, especially with the more widespread use of AI-powered LLM systems? In this episode, host ⁠Will Francis⁠⁠ has a fascinating discussion with Sean Falconer about how companies of any size can securely store customer data, how fines from data regulations like GDPR and CCPA are putting increased pressure on companies, and how AI models can be trained on data while still protecting privacy.

Sean is head of marketing at Skyflow, a data privacy vault service, and host of the Software Huddle podcast.

Ahead of the Game - The Importance of Digital Accessibility
play

05/13/22 • 49 min

Digital accessibility is more than a catchphrase, or a legal requirement – it’s a mindset that brands and marketers need to be much more aware of and consider building into their strategy. In this week’s episode, host Will Francis meets with Mark Miller and Cori Perlander of leading US-based accessibility consultancy TGPi. Cori shares her experience of seeing and hearing the internet on a daily basis, and Mark – also the host of the TPGI podcast – explains the ideas behind WCAG, VPATs, and the importance of screen readers like JAWS to open up opportunities to a greater audience. In Cori’s words: “as a person with a disability, I'm not looking for a handout, I just want to be able to use my technology to complete actions and to maintain independence.”

Ahead of the Game - The Human Touch in AI Copywriting
play

03/08/24 • 72 min

AI is now an integral part of copywriting. But how do we consider the line between craft and automation, between efficiency and creativity? How do we balance the human touch?

In this episode, DMI podcast producer and today's host, Emma Prunty, is joined by marketing strategist Julie Atherton, and veteran copywriter and AI educator Kerry Harrison.

Some of the key points in an insightful, wide-ranging conversation:

  • Which AI tools work best for copywriters
  • How to ensure the 'human' remains part of the strategic and creative process, such as through Kerry's concept of an 'AI sandwich'
  • Ethics in the application and development of AI
  • Transparency between clients and copywriters about AI use and implementing AI policies
  • Gender bias in AI models and what we can do about it...
  • ...the ongoing importance of encouraging girls and women in tech
